1. Explore the Port Hudson State Historic Site

Delving into History
Start your Zachary adventure at the Port Hudson State Historic Site, where one of the longest sieges of the American Civil War took place. Why not walk the trails and witness the preserved earthworks and trenches? It’s like stepping back in time!
